L98 Iron Heads - Head Gasket and Valve Spring Part Numbers
 
Hello All,
I just got the call from the machine shop and they need a gasket set for the valve seals. I can find a bunch of information on the aluminum heads to go with the Felpro 1010 or the 1003 gaskets. But, what should I get with the iron heads?

I would prefer a kit if possible.

Also what type and where should I get valve springs for a stock cam and stock rockers? I may put in 1.6 rollers later. People mention the ZZ4 springs but what part number should I be getting? and will they work with the iron head?

again , theres alot of folks ahead of you on these upgrades , so you'll find lots of info on this site, and, you'll have a bunch of opinions on this and it depends what you're going to do with it, but for a stock street setup I'm a believer in compcams. What I liked bout the ecklers setup was that it included everything, push rods, locks, nuts, fulcrums, I went with the roller tip 1.6's cause I didnt want the extra issues with full rollers, went with the springs they sell for the same reason, just wanted to bolt things on and run it with out it being tempramental. The price for their compcam kit was less than i could get it from compcams in seperate pieces. hope this helps.

Tou can use the 7733 PT2 with iron or alluminum heads. A set of old Z28 springs will work with a stock cam. I think you can get them from GM for cheap. No point in spending big $$$ when you dont need to. :cheers:
